**Handover: Fernhollow profile-store sharding**

State as of today: shards 1–4 are live with dual writes enabled; shards 5–8 are provisioned but not receiving traffic. The backfill job for legacy rows is about 60% complete and resumes from a checkpoint table. For the reviewer: the open PR changes only routing logic, not the backfill. Verify the consistent-hash ring matches the config map. Questions on intent should go to the engineer below.

signatory, kaweg-fawig: Zorys Druys Jorius Novael

## Quota enforcement

Per-tenant quotas on Ferngate are enforced at the edge. Defaults: 600 req/min, burst 120. Overrides live in the quota map; plugins must not cache quota values longer than 60s. To query the quota service from your plugin sandbox, set the credential in your env file with this line:

secret setting of yafof-tawep: RELAY_SECRET8=8abb5772

Subject: Key rotation for Quillbus broker upgrade

Team — as part of Thursday's Quillbus upgrade to v9, we are rotating the credential the orchestration layer uses to publish to the broker admin API. The old key stops working at cutover. Please update your local tooling before the sync on Friday. The replacement key for the staging admin endpoint is as follows:

app token of tadug-yahag = vxb3-949

**Alert: SplitPane diff renderer lagging on large files**

Heads up — SplitPane's diff viewer is timing out on files over ~40MB again. Users hitting the Corvid monorepo see spinners that never resolve, and the chunking worker queue is backing up. Usually this means the tokenizer pool is starved; a rolling restart of the `diff-chunker` pods clears it in most cases. If that doesn't help, flip the `coarse-diff` fallback flag and page the Lanternfall team. Triage steps and the flag console are documented on the page below.

dashboard of yahaf-kajep = https://jira.zemvarsys.internal/display/projects/browse/browse/a08b